When it comes to purchasing THCa in Cebolla, New Mexico, located in Rio Arriba County, there are several factors to consider. The debate around sourcing cannabis products locally versus online is multifaceted and presents a variety of perspectives.

Local Availability and Community Support

One argument for buying THCa locally is the support it provides to community businesses. Purchasing from local dispensaries can foster economic growth within Cebolla and help sustain small enterprises that contribute to the local economy. Furthermore, buying locally often means you have access to knowledgeable staff who can provide personalized advice based on your specific needs and preferences.

Quality Assurance and Product Variety

On the other hand, some consumers might argue that sourcing THCa from larger or more established retailers outside of their immediate area could offer a wider selection of products. These larger operations may have the resources to ensure stringent quality control measures are in place, potentially reducing concerns about product consistency and safety.

Environmental Considerations

Another angle worth considering is the environmental impact associated with purchasing THCa. Buying locally reduces the carbon footprint linked with shipping products over long distances. This consideration aligns with a growing awareness among consumers about sustainable practices and their role in reducing environmental harm.

Supporting local businesses not only strengthens community ties but also promotes sustainability by minimizing transportation emissions.

Legal Aspects and Accessibility

It’s important to acknowledge that legal considerations might also play a role in this decision-making process. Regulations surrounding cannabis can vary significantly even within states like New Mexico, affecting both availability and legality of certain products. For residents of Cebolla, understanding these nuances ensures compliance while accessing desired cannabis products.

In conclusion, whether you choose to purchase THCa locally or consider options beyond Rio Arriba County depends on various factors including personal values related to community support, product quality preferences, environmental concerns, and legal constraints. Balancing these aspects allows for an informed decision tailored to individual priorities while appreciating diverse viewpoints on this complex issue.

Definition:


  • THCa: Tetrahydrocannabinolic acid, a non-psychoactive cannabinoid found in raw cannabis plants that converts to THC when heated.
  • Cebolla: A community located in Rio Arriba County, New Mexico.
  • Rio Arriba County: A county located in the northern part of the state of New Mexico, USA.
